Measurement and Analysis of China's Digital Infrastructure Level
Journal: Modern Economics & Management Forum DOI: 10.32629/memf.v6i1.3562
Abstract
This paper measures the level of digital infrastructure in different provinces of China from 2013 to 2022 using the entropy weight method. The research findings indicate that China's digital infrastructure has been improving over the years, but regional disparities exist, with the eastern region having a higher level compared to the central and western regions. Therefore, it is crucial for each province to strengthen the construction of digital infrastructure to promote the development of the digital economy and achieve balanced regional growth.
